I recently added the 92 Carrera Cup and the 911 3.8 RSR by Fujimi to my stash. Upon looking at photos of the 1:1 racers there is no evidence of a sunroof, yet Fujimi has included them. Even the thought of a comp vehicle having the extra weight and mechanics of one seems out-of-place. Will my first task be filling in the seams to produce a full roof? I think so...

Fujimi gets cheap sometimes and does not modify their stock body kits for their competition versions.  In addition they have been known to include only stock interior and no roll cage parts for their race/rally kits. Frustrating!

I agree JC, odd thing with the RSR kit they include an interior with the rear seats molded in, thankfully they include a set of Recaros in addition to a single comp style seat, along with a minimal roll cage missing the door cross braces. A mishmash for sure.

I cut out the seat cushions and seat back and filled the openings with sheet plastic to get a competition look for my C4 Lightweight project.  I scratch built a full roll cage.
